Debating plays a considerable component in a lot of government decisions and procedures. In terms of how to prepare for a debate in government settings, practice makes perfect. To put it simply, practicing your public speaking skills and doing mock debates with other people in advance is a great way to grow your debating skills. Considering that debating is all about persuading individuals, the way you present yourself plays a really vital role in exactly how persuasive your argument is. Ultimately, individuals will certainly not be convinced if you seem insecure or uncertain about yourself and your argument. This is why some of the best public debate tips is to project your voice clearly and loudly, hold your head high website and stand straight, make eye contact with your opponent and emphasise your point with hand gestures.

In terms of how to debate in parliament, the top rule is to stay cool, considerate and objective. Although there could be particular subject matters which are personal to you, it is necessary to not let your passion transform into anger or frustration. A terrific debater is able to put aside their personal point of views, maintain composure and appear objective in their argument. Actually, there may even be occasions where you are alloted to the side of the debate you do not agree with, which is why being versatile and adaptable is absolutely fundamental.

When it pertains to debating, the number one bit of advice is to thoroughly and meticulously prepare. Typically the debate subject will be identified beforehand, which provides you a little bit of time to do some wider reading and research study into all the nuances of the topic. Primarily, decide whether you support or oppose the statement or subject matter that you are debating. Of course, it is not enough to just say your position; you need to back up your argument with concrete examples, precise statistics and non-biased research. Draw upon these numbers as supporting evidence for why your argument is right. While it is good to try and memorise all your points, it is a good idea to prepare some cue cards or prompts to bring with you in case you forget certain specifics.
